Secret Factors Affecting RLE Candidateship



When taking into consideration refractive lens exchange (RLE), numerous vital variables can influence your candidacy.

First, your age plays a considerable duty; RLE is typically advised for those over 40, as presbyopia comes to be much more prevalent.

Next off, your overall eye health and wellness is important. Conditions like cataracts or serious dry eye can impact your eligibility.



Additionally, your refractive error-- whether you're nearsighted, farsighted, or have astigmatism-- will certainly be examined, as particular conditions react far better to RLE.

Lifestyle aspects, including your daily tasks and visual needs, also issue.

Last but not least, sensible assumptions about the results of the treatment are necessary.
